You have the right not to vote for any candiadate, but as QueEx said, it is imperative that you do vote.

I truly can sympathize with the disenchantment people have with either of the major political parties and candidates. I have may disappoints too.

However, looking for a perfect candidate is very unrealistic.

What all of us should be doing is getting personally involved with the political party of your choice.

The one aspect of the Tea Party i do admire is how they infiltrated local republican parties and influenced them to such a degree, the national leaders dare not ignore them.

This may be to the detriment of the GOP in national elections, but they are having an influence in what the republican polices are.

Fortunately or unfortunately, depending how you view it, we are not a parliamentary system. We do not replace our government at the rates the European's do.
